#1b8200 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1b8200 is composed of 10.6% red, 51%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 107.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.5%. #1b8200 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ff00 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#1b8200 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1b8200 has RGB values of R:27, G:130,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:1,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1802752.

Hex triplet 1b8200 #1b8200
RGB Decimal 27, 130, 0 rgb(27,130,0)
RGB Percent 10.6, 51, 0 rgb(10.6%,51%,0%)
CMYK 79, 0, 100, 49
HSL 107.5°, 100, 25.5 hsl(107.5,100%,25.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 107.5°, 100, 51
Web Safe 339900 #339900
CIE-LAB 47.232, -49.536, 50.83
XYZ 8.434, 16.197, 2.682
xyY 0.309, 0.593, 16.197
CIE-LCH 47.232, 70.976, 134.261
CIE-LUV 47.232, -41.633, 57.442
Hunter-Lab 40.246, -33.023, 24.221
Binary 00011011, 10000010, 00000000

Shades and Tints of #1b8200

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c00 is the darkest color, while #f9fff8 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1b8200 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#545454 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#495d43 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#867700 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#947122 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#497f88 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5f7b00 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#687715 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#388056 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
